They're calling it a miracle - a 4-year-old girl abducted from the yard of her home, found safe 70 miles away more than 24 hours later.
The FBI says witnesses late Tuesday saw what they thought was a little boy wandering around a suburban St. Louis car wash. It turned out to be 4-year-old Alisa Maier, abducted Monday night from the yard of her home in Louisiana, Missouri.
Alisa was taken to a hospital for evaluation.
Her grandfather, Roy Harrison, told NBC's Today Show on NewsFirst5 on Wednesday that she appeared to be unharmed.
Police are searching for the dark-colored sedan that Alisa's 6-year-old brother reported was used in the abduction, and that witnesses saw around the car wash in Fenton.
Harrison urged the suspect to turn himself in.
